Ras Al Khaimah: A man has been sentenced to three months in jail after pleading guilty to charges of bestiality.

The camel involved in the case is to be put down in accordance with Islamic law.

A court official said the Bangladeshi, who worked as a driver, had been spotted going into his employer's barn on a regular basis. His employer became suspicious as his duties did not involve him dealing with animals.

The official said the employer, a UAE national, followed his driver into the barn one day and saw him starting to have sex with a female camel.

The owner lost his temper and started beating him. He then took him to the police station to
press charges.

The official said the driver confessed to police that he used to have sex with one particular camel. The police arrested him and the case was referred to the Public Prosecution.

The official added the man told the prosecution that he had fallen in love with the camel and had sex with the animal. The emirate's Criminal Court sentenced him on Wednesday to three months in jail, to be followed by deportation.
